Default Update on Diddy

I went to see a different vet today because this has been bothering me. They think it is a histiocytoma (I hope I spelled that right) and there is a 50/50 chance that it will go away by itself. It could be weeks or months. Since he is so young there is only a 1% chance that it is cancerous. Thank goodness!

If it does not go away within 2 weeks or if it gets any bigger I am having it removed. I feel a little better about all this now but still worried about my little guy!

Default Update on Diddy

I took Diddy to the vet today for his recheck. Great news, the lump is starting to go away on its own! They said that is definitley a histiocytoma and I have nothing to worry about. I am sooooo relieved! Yay!

Now I just have to deal with his allergies and his reverse sneezing and all will be well.
